Title: The Innovations of Anthony Eckhoff
Introduction
Anthony Eckhoff is a notable inventor based in Cocoa, Florida, who has made significant contributions to the field of wireless instrumentation and signal processing. With a total of 5 patents to his name, Eckhoff's work focuses on enhancing communication systems and improving the efficiency of signal conditioning amplifiers.
Latest Patents
Eckhoff's latest patents include a wireless instrumentation system and a real-time calibration method for signal conditioning amplifiers. The wireless instrumentation system enables a plurality of low power wireless transceivers to transmit measurement data from various remote station sensors to a central data station accurately and reliably. This innovative system employs a relay-based communications scheme, allowing remote stations that cannot communicate directly with the central station to relay information through other stations. Additionally, a unique power management scheme is implemented to minimize power usage at each remote station, thereby maximizing battery life. Each remote station is designed with a modular approach to facilitate easy reconfiguration as needed.
The real-time calibration method for signal conditioning amplifiers involves a process where an amplifier receives an input signal from a transducer. The signal is amplified and processed through an analog-to-digital converter before being sent to a processor. The processor estimates the input signal and provides a calibration voltage to the amplifier. This calibration voltage is then compared to the amplified input signal, allowing for adjustments to the gain and/or offset of the amplifier if significant errors are detected.
Career Highlights
Eckhoff's career is marked by his work with the United States of America as represented by the Administrator of NASA. His innovative contributions have played a crucial role in advancing technology in the field of wireless communication and signal processing.
Collaborations
Throughout his career, Eckhoff has collaborated with talented individuals such as Jose M Perotti and Pedro J Medelius, further enhancing the impact of his work.
